Output 6177da80a75c9a6881b2848c86ad7efc0ad7751cb32e783cdbd69ee3ce92b6e5:2

value
2339664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e1c66fdaaafa20eb0c3f48061c1e015243a1d80 OP_EQUALVERIFY OP_CHECKSIG
address
12HcV7Xm8zy8vfg42HMyPDdkRBhSQLgjTA
transaction
6177da80a75c9a6881b2848c86ad7efc0ad7751cb32e783cdbd69ee3ce92b6e5
confirmations
694034
spent
true